What are Vegetarian Digestive Enzymes?

Vegetarian digestive enzymes are supplements that contain enzymes sourced from non-animal origins, primarily plants and fungi. Unlike many traditional enzyme supplements that use animal-derived pancreatin, these alternatives provide a cruelty-free and often more robust solution for digestive support.

Plant-Derived Enzymes

Certain plants are naturally rich in digestive enzymes. These raw foods contain enzymes that begin to break down the food as soon as it is chewed. Two of the most well-known plant-based enzymes are bromelain and papain.

  • Bromelain: A group of protein-digesting enzymes (proteases) found in the stems and fruit of pineapples. Besides its digestive properties, it is also known for its anti-inflammatory effects.
  • Papain: A protease enzyme extracted from the unripe papaya fruit. It is used to aid protein digestion and can help with symptoms of bloating and diarrhea.

Other plant-based sources include mangos (amylase) and avocados (lipase), but supplementary forms are typically derived from controlled extraction processes for potency.

Fungal-Derived Enzymes

Many of the most effective and widely used vegetarian digestive enzymes are actually produced through the fermentation of specific fungi, such as Aspergillus species. This microbial sourcing allows for the production of a wide range of enzymes that are highly stable and active across the entire pH range of the human gastrointestinal tract. Fungal-based blends often contain:

  • Protease: For breaking down proteins.
  • Amylase/Diastase: For breaking down carbohydrates like starch.
  • Lipase: For breaking down fats.
  • Cellulase: For digesting dietary fiber, an enzyme not naturally produced by the human body.
  • Alpha-Galactosidase: An enzyme that breaks down complex carbohydrates in beans and legumes to reduce gas and bloating.
  • Lactase: For breaking down lactose, the sugar in dairy products.

How Vegetarian Enzymes Work

The mechanism of action for vegetarian digestive enzymes is what makes them particularly effective for a wide audience, especially those on a varied diet. They mimic and support the body's natural enzyme production to enhance the breakdown of food.

Broad-Spectrum Action and pH Stability

Unlike animal-sourced enzymes like pancreatin, which are most active in the alkaline environment of the small intestine, microbial enzymes are uniquely stable across a wide pH range, from the acidic stomach to the more neutral small intestine. This means they start working earlier in the digestive process and continue their work through the entire GI tract, providing more complete and efficient digestion. This broader activity range is a key reason for their efficacy in reducing bloating, gas, and discomfort after meals.

Targeting Specific Macronutrients

Different enzymes target different types of food. A quality vegetarian enzyme blend will contain a combination of enzymes to handle a balanced meal:

  • Proteases (Papain, Bromelain, Fungal Protease): Break down complex protein chains into smaller, absorbable amino acids. This is especially important for plant-based proteins, which can sometimes be harder to digest due to associated anti-nutrients.
  • Amylase (from Fungi): Breaks down starches and complex carbohydrates into simple sugars, improving energy availability.
  • Lipase (from Fungi): Breaks down dietary fats into fatty acids and glycerol, essential for energy and hormone production.
  • Fiber-digesting enzymes (Cellulase, Hemicellulase): Breakdown plant fibers, which are indigestible by human enzymes. This helps reduce bloating from high-fiber foods and enhances nutrient extraction.

Vegetarian vs. Animal Digestive Enzymes Comparison

For those considering enzyme supplementation, understanding the key differences between vegetarian and animal-based products is crucial.

Feature Vegetarian Enzymes (Plant/Fungal) Animal Enzymes (Pancreatin/Pepsin)
Source Plants (pineapple, papaya) and cultivated fungi (Aspergillus species) Animal pancreas, specifically from pigs and cows
pH Activity Stable and active across a wide pH range (approx. 3.0-9.0), working in both the stomach and intestines Active in a narrow, more alkaline pH range, primarily functioning in the small intestine
Digestive Spectrum Broad-spectrum, breaking down proteins, fats, carbs, and fiber Primarily focused on protein and fat digestion, with minimal carbohydrate or fiber-digesting activity
Potency Can often be concentrated more highly than animal versions, offering greater activity per capsule Requires higher dosages to achieve equivalent activity levels due to lower concentration
Suitability Ideal for vegetarians, vegans, and those with specific dietary restrictions or allergies Not suitable for vegans or vegetarians; some individuals may also have ethical concerns or allergies

Finding the Right Vegetarian Digestive Enzyme Supplement

When selecting a supplement, consider the following points to ensure it meets your specific needs:

  • Look for Broad-Spectrum Blends: Choose a product that combines proteases, amylases, and lipases to support the digestion of all macronutrients. Add-ons like alpha-galactosidase and lactase are beneficial if you consume beans or dairy, respectively.
  • Check the Source: Ensure the label specifies the enzymes are plant- or fungal-derived, as opposed to animal-sourced pancreatin.
  • Consider Activity Units: Don't just look at the enzyme weight in milligrams (mg); look for specific activity units like DU (amylase), HUT (protease), or FIP (lipase), which indicate potency.

Natural Sources of Vegetarian Enzymes

In addition to supplements, a variety of raw and fermented foods contain natural enzymes that can aid digestion. Incorporating these foods into your diet can provide an added boost to your digestive system.

  • Pineapple: Contains bromelain.
  • Papaya: Rich in papain.
  • Mango: Contains amylase, which helps break down starches.
  • Avocado: A source of lipase, an enzyme that digests fats.
  • Fermented Foods: Items like sauerkraut, kimchi, and rejuvelac (from sprouted grains) contain a variety of enzymes and probiotics.
